State police at Kiski Valley report investigating alleged criminal mischief Feb. 27 at 2 p.m. at a Richmond Street residence in Derry Township. According to the report, a 26-year-old Loyalhanna male told troopers that his storm door was dented by the father of his ex-girlfriend by forcefully pushing the door open. The investigation continues.

Jacob Cholock was sworn in as Latrobe's newest full-time police officer Monday night. City council during its regular meeting approved hiring Cholock, who was selected among 14 candidates. Police Chief John Sleasman said Cholock excelled in the civil service selection process. "He rose to the cream of the crop right away," Sleasman said.

Officers took Peter A. Letso, 49, of Latrobe into custody after an hour-long standoff Tuesday morning on Oak Street in Latrobe. Police were called to the home after it was reported Letso allegedly had a gun and was threatening to kill anyone if he was forced to leave.
